Virgin Mobile
 4 Out of 5
Phone Model: Audiovox Flasher |
General, Paonia, CO 81428 |
Fri Apr 06, 2007 |
I live 5 miles west of town and get 5 bars consistently. BUT, I will lose service at random times for random periods. I will have 5 bars then no service at all for a day or so. Doesn't happen often, but still. Good service in most parts of town, a couple low reception sites, but can still make useful calls. You lose service quickly driving east on highway 133, towards Somerset, but so do my friends with Cingular (stupid mountains). Virgin uses the Sprint tower(s). Besides Cingular, no other carriers offer service. Verizon has no plans to expand here neither does tmobile. I've had VM since 2005.
